The Science behind Antiaging Products

Antiaging products work by tackling the core reasons behind skin aging. As we age, the production of fundamental skin-supporting elements such as collagen and elastin slows down. External factors such as sun exposure, environmental pollutants, and stress can further exacerbate this process. Antiaging products are designed to counteract these effects by boosting the skin’s natural regenerative processes and protecting it from future damage.

Components of Effective Antiaging Products

Effective antiaging products typically contain ingredients that promote skin health and rejuvenation. Some of these essentials include retinol, a vitamin A derivative known for its wrinkle-smoothing properties; hyaluronic acid, which provides deep hydration to the skin; peptides, the small proteins that stimulate collagen production; antioxidants like vitamin C and E that neutralize harmful free radicals and promote skin repair; and sunscreens that shield the skin from sun damage.

Choosing the Right Antiaging Products for Your Skin

When selecting an antiaging product, it’s crucial to consider your specific skin type and concerns. Not every product will suit everyone. People with dry skin may need heavier, oil-based products, while those with oily skin may benefit from lighter, water-based formulas. Furthermore, certain ingredients might cause irritation or allergies in sensitive skin types. Therefore, it is advised to do a patch test before applying any new product to the face.

The Role of Lifestyle in Antiaging

While antiaging products can provide significant benefits, they should not be viewed as the be-all and end-all of anti-aging efforts. A healthy lifestyle plays an equally, if not more, important role in maintaining youthful skin. Regular exercise, a balanced diet rich in fruits and vegetables, getting adequate sleep, and staying hydrated can contribute positively to your skin’s health and appearance. Moreover, habits like smoking and excessive alcohol consumption can speed up the skin aging process and should be avoided.
